Linux Aliases怎样设置别名有效期
导读:在Linux中,别名(alias)通常在当前shell会话中有效。如果你想要设置别名的有效期,可以考虑以下几种方法: 临时设置别名:在当前shell会话中设置别名,关闭会话后别名失效。例如: alias myalias='echo "H...
在Linux中,别名(alias)通常在当前shell会话中有效。如果你想要设置别名的有效期,可以考虑以下几种方法:
- 临时设置别名:在当前shell会话中设置别名,关闭会话后别名失效。例如:
alias myalias='echo "Hello, World!"'
- 将别名添加到~/.bashrc文件:将别名添加到用户的~/.bashrc文件中,这样每次打开新的shell会话时,别名都会生效。例如:
echo 'alias myalias="echo Hello, World!"' >
>
~/.bashrc
source ~/.bashrc
- 设置别名的有效期:如果你想要设置别名的有效期,可以使用at命令来实现。首先,确保已经安装了at服务,然后按照以下步骤操作:
- 使用
at命令设置一个定时任务,指定别名失效的时间。例如,如果你想要在7天后使别名失效,可以执行以下命令:
echo 'alias myalias="echo Hello, World!"' | at now + 7 days
- 若要删除已设置的别名,可以使用
atrm命令,后面跟上任务的ID。例如:
atrm <
任务ID>
请注意,这种方法仅适用于一次性任务,而不是永久性的别名设置。如果你需要在多个会话中使用别名,建议将其添加到~/.bashrc文件中。
声明:本文内容由网友自发贡献,本站不承担相应法律责任。对本内容有异议或投诉,请联系2913721942#qq.com核实处理,我们将尽快回复您,谢谢合作!
若转载请注明出处: Linux Aliases怎样设置别名有效期
本文地址: https://pptw.com/jishu/733834.html
